What Bathroom Remodeling Sales Pays in Bradenton, FL
Most bathroom and shower remodeling sales reps in Bradenton earn between $75,000 and $200,000 OTE, depending on the company, product line, and how consistently they close. The job is structured around high-ticket sales: a single walk-in bath or full bathroom conversion can carry a ticket price of $8,000 to $25,000 or more. At those numbers, closing four to six jobs per month puts you well on track toward six figures annually without needing a massive pipeline.
Compensation is almost always commission-based, with many companies offering a base draw against commission plus performance bonuses for hitting weekly or monthly quota. Some of the top earners in this vertical in Florida are pulling $200k+ sales jobs worth of income because they master a clean, repeatable demo and rarely leave a home without a signed agreement. No degree required. What companies are hiring for is coachability, confidence in front of a homeowner, and the discipline to run every appointment with the same energy.
Why Bradenton Is a Strong Market for Home Improvement Sales
Bradenton and the surrounding Manatee County area has a large and growing retiree population, which directly drives demand for walk-in baths and accessibility-focused bathroom remodels. Aging homeowners want to stay in their homes longer, and a bathroom conversion is one of the first upgrades they invest in. That means the emotional and practical buying motive is already present before you walk through the door.
Beyond demographics, Bradenton's steady new resident growth from both in-state and out-of-state buyers means more homeowners making improvements to properties they plan to hold long-term. Combine that with the area's above-average median home values and you have a market where homeowners have equity, have the intent to spend, and respond well to a consultative in-home sales approach.
What the Sales Role Actually Looks Like Day to Day
Most bathroom remodeling sales jobs in this market follow a straightforward structure. Companies handle lead generation and appointment setting, so your primary job is to show up prepared, run a thorough in-home consultation, present the product, and close. Here is the typical sequence for a top-performing rep in this vertical:
- Pre-appointment prep: Review the homeowner's profile, confirm the appointment, and arrive with a clear understanding of which products, walk-in tubs, shower conversions, or full remodels, match the household's likely needs.
- Build rapport and assess the bathroom: Walk the space with the homeowner, ask discovery questions, and identify the core pain points around safety, aesthetics, or functionality.
- Present the solution: Run a structured demo that walks the homeowner through the product, the installation process, and the financing options available. Specificity builds trust at this stage.
- Handle objections: Strong objection handling is what separates closers from order-takers. Address concerns about price, timing, and contractor reliability with confidence and evidence.
- Close on the same visit: The one-call close model means you are working toward a signed agreement and deposit before you leave the home. Companies in this space do not expect second visits.
- Submit and celebrate: Log the deal, submit your paperwork, and prepare for the next appointment. The best reps treat each close as a repeatable system, not a lucky outcome.
